Problems solved by technology

[0003] At present, the trolley on the workbench is fixed on the rear by bolts and cooperates with the central pin shaft to bend the steel bar. When it is necessary to bend the steel bar specifications with different diameters, it is necessary to manually adjust the trolley to a suitable position and then fix it. Bending steel bars with different diameters affects the bending efficiency of the steel bars, and the steel bars to be bent are placed directly between the bending pin and the center pin, which is easy to cause deviation due to uneven stress on the steel bars during the bending process , affecting the bending quality

Abstract

The invention discloses a construction device for an energy-saving building. The construction device for the energy-saving building comprises a shell, and the interior of the shell is of a hollow structure. A reduction box is fixed to the inner wall of the right side of the shell through a first fixing bolt, and a transmission shaft penetrates through the top end of the shell. A working table is arranged at the upper end of the transmission shaft, and the working table is provided with a plurality of central pin shafts at equal intervals in the circumferential direction. The central pin shaftsare detachably installed on the upper surface of the working table, and supporting pin shafts are arranged at the front ends of the central pin shafts in a left-right symmetric mode. A bending mechanism is arranged in front of the working table. The depths and heights of stepped structures on a first bent pin shaft, a second bent pin shaft, the central pin shafts and the supporting pin shafts areset to be the same, steel bars do not offset during bending, the supporting pin shafts with different diameters and specifications are arranged on the working table, so that manual replacement of thesupporting pin shafts are not required during bending, the bending time can be greatly saved, the bending efficiency is improved, and the bending quality of the steel bars is effectively ensured.
